Finally finished my winter project...1991 Club Car DS
This started as a run of the mill 1991 Club Car DS 36 volt resistor cart. I tore the whole cart down and cleaned, sanded, and re-painted everything. I replaced all the hardware (nuts and bolts) on the suspension. I coated the frame and under carriage assembly with spray on truck bed liner. I upgraded the electrical system to 48 volt, new solenoid, PB-6 pot box, 6 new Crown CR-190 8 volt batteries, D&D ES-58 torque motor, AllTrax AXE 650 amp controller, onboard Delta-Q Quiq 48 volt charger, and #2 AWG welding cable wires.
After prep, the body was brought to a local sign shop where it where it was base coated, air brushed, and cleared. Added 6" Jake's spindle lift, Jake's front disc brake kit, All Sports running boards, ITP SS 212 chrome rims with ITP 23"x10"x12" all trail tires, new seat covers, and some good dres up items by Strech Plastics. I'm very happy with how my first cart turned out. Now I'm going to try and start a business of doing this. Many Thanks to Justin at 3R Sales for supplying me with all my parts!!! |
